Output 0423757e3ab4acb91f989b123f2e15ff060f5ca90ef88fe2a8b6e5e208797c70:6

value
994394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64612c413898d20b4280ae1965e86792fa301f98 OP_EQUAL
address
3AqmuR6HkgM7bEWuQmSyDnWa272Uw5du5v
transaction
0423757e3ab4acb91f989b123f2e15ff060f5ca90ef88fe2a8b6e5e208797c70
spent
true